The use of wireless security cameras has become increasingly popular over recent years. This surge in interest is due to many reasons. Some people use wireless security cameras for their ease of installation. Other people use them because running wires is impossible or not cost effective. Whatever the reason may be, wireless security cameras are quickly becoming the preferred method of surveillance for many people. Wireless security cameras are so popular because users can literally put them anywhere added protection is needed -- and the user doesn't have to worry about wires. The placement of a security system is very flexible and easy to install, as long as the installer does his or her homework. Wireless security cameras have a very high failure rate on initial install if precautions are not taken. What sort of …show more content…

In ideal conditions with line of sight, you can stretch it to 300 feet (in theory). In reality though, that is never the case. The signal strength is reduced by interference and walls. If you are looking for a camera that can transmit video up to 500 feet away, you need a camera with at least a 100mw transmitter. For a distance greater than that, let's say 1,000 feet to 2,000 feet, you need a system with a one watt transmitter. These are very general numbers and can change based on the distance, weather, and availability of a clear line of sight. A good way to increase the odds of success is to put the security camera and receiver antenna as high as possible so that they have a clear line of sight. Before making any purchases however, ensure that you identify your own specific needs for a security system so that you receive the proper protection for your home or business.
